"Former Rep Koko, 9 APC Officials Suspended in Kebbi State"





By Umar Faruk, Birnin Kebbi



The All Progressives Congress (APC) in Kebbi State has suspended former Member of the House of Representatives for Koko/Maiyama Federal Constituency, Muhammad Shehu Koko, along with nine party officials in Koko-Besse Local Government Area. The suspended party officials include Muhammad Danyado, APC Vice Chairman of Koko-Besse LGA; Biyaminu Muhammad, Secretary; and Talatu Zauro, Women Leader.

Others suspended are the Youth Leader, Financial Secretary, Welfare Secretary, and several other party officials. According to a suspension letter obtained by Series News Online, the action was taken due to alleged anti-party activities, disloyalty, and harassment of the party’s executive members.

The letter was jointly signed by the APC Local Government Party Chairman, Muhammad Maibarga, the Local Government Executive Chairman, Sirajo Usman Koko, and 14 other stakeholders of the party in the area. "The suspension is due to their alleged involvement in activities that are detrimental to the party's interest," the letter stated.
However, close associates of the former lawmaker disclosed  that they were not authorized to speak on his behalf. They hinted that the suspension may be linked to his reported intention to contest for a senatorial seat, which has allegedly unsettled certain influential figures within the APC in Kebbi State.
